Skeet's Blues
They left Rome very early this morning and will reach Kazakhstan this afternoon Skeet blues who will take part in the fifth round of the ISSF World Cup of the 2023 international season. In Almaty, the coach of the Azzurri national team, Andrea Filippetti, will accompany them on the platform. Competing will be Tammaro Cassandro (Carabinieri) from Capua (CE), Gabriele Rossetti (Fiamme Oro) from Ponte Buggianese (PT), Domenico Simeone (Fiamme Oro) from Baia and Latina (CE) and Giancarlo Tazza (Fiamme Oro) from Caserta ( CE) for men, while for women Diana Bacosi (Army) of Cetona (SI), Chiara Cainero (Carabinieri) of Cavalicco di Tavagnacco (UD), Simona Scocchetti (Army) of Tarquinia (VT) and Martina Bartolomei (Air Force) of Laterina (AR).
The competition programme
On Sunday 21st May they will face the Official Trainings, while the first part of the match will take place on Monday 22nd May with 75 targets, followed by the other 23 targets on 50rd May. When it will be 12.00 in Italy, the Women's Skeet finals will begin, while at 13.00 pm in Italy the Men's Skeet finals. The finals will take place according to the new ISSF regulation which eliminates the semifinals and the medal matches and returns to being the one already seen at the Tokyo 2020 Olympic Games. At the end of the qualifications, the six best shooters and the six best shooters will compete in the final to progressive eliminations (for Skeet with 20 clay pigeons sixth place will be decreed, 30 the fifth, 40 the fourth, 50 the third and 60 the first and second place, ed).
